Sr. Application Developer Job Description

Sr. Application Developer Job Description Template

Our company is looking for a Sr. Application Developer to join our team.

Responsibilities:

  • Assist in the development of logical and physical specifications;
  • Identify, analyze, and develop interfaces and flows;
  • Assist in the collection and documentation of user’s requirements;
  • Propose and evangelize development standards across multiple projects and vendors;
  • Develop solutions by designing system specifications, standards and programming;
  • Identify and communicate technical problems, processes, and solutions;
  • Documents designs, issues, solutions, tips & tricks as needed;
  • Other duties as assigned;
  • Stays current in new IT technologies to maintain a high level of subject matter expertise;
  • Develops unit tests and provides code coverage to accurately test business logic and functionality;
  • Participates in developing specifications such as user stories and designs;
  • Create high-quality source code to program complete applications within deadlines;
  • Prepare creative prototypes according to specifications;
  • Review existing applications to reprogram, update and add new features;
  • Provide daily project updates to the customer Program Manager and management team.
